FSSAI Annual Return Filing is a compulsory statutory compliance requirement under Regulation 2.1.13 of the Food Safety and Standards (Licensing and Registration of Food Businesses) Regulations, 2011. Every food business operator (FBO) holding an FSSAI State License or Central License—engaged in manufacturing, importing, exporting, packaging, labeling, or re-labeling of food products—is legally mandated to file an annual return in statutory Form D-1 on the official FoSCoS portal.
The statutory deadline for submitting the FSSAI Annual Return is May 31st of every year, covering the production and trade data of the preceding financial year (April 1st to March 31st). The return requires precise quantitative declarations of food products manufactured, handled, imported, or exported, along with their sales value, countries of destination, and storage capacities. Failure to submit Form D-1 within the statutory timeframe triggers an immediate, non-negotiable late penalty of ₹100 per day of delay from June 1st onwards.

FSSAI Annual Return Filing (Form D-1) is legally mandatory for specific categories of licensed food business operators in India. You are strictly required to file an annual return if your business falls under any of the following categories: • Licensed Food Manufacturers: All food processing units, manufacturing plants, breweries, slaughterhouses, and packaging units holding an FSSAI State License or Central License. • Food Importers & Exporters: Entities holding an FSSAI Central License for importing food items into India or exporting Indian food products abroad. • Relabellers & Repackers: Businesses that purchase bulk food products and repack, relabel, or re-brand them under their own private labels with a valid State or Central License. • Dairy Processors & Milk Chilling Units: Licensed dairy farms, milk processing plants, and chilling centers handling commercial quantities of milk and milk products. Important Exemption Note: Petty Food Business Operators holding an FSSAI Basic Registration (turnover under ₹12 Lakhs), pure retail grocers, restaurants, canteens, distributors, and wholesalers who do not engage in any manufacturing, importing, or repacking activities are exempted from filing statutory Form D-1 annual returns.
